Generative artificial intelligence (AI) like ChatGPT is improving the productivity of some professionals, but its full-scale implementation requires extensive regulatory development. In this respect reports The BNN publication refers to the words of philanthropist and Microsoft founder Bill Gates at the World Economic Forum in Davos (Switzerland).
According to Gates, the emergence of generative AI has led to significant improvements in human productivity in some areas. For example, programmers report an increase in productivity of up to 50%; AI does a good job of solving routine coding tasks. Gates also highlighted the potential dependence on AI interactions and called for careful consideration of the use of the technology in workflows.
The billionaire also emphasized that artificial intelligence has a long way to go towards legal integration. According to him, improving the regulatory framework in the context of artificial intelligence will be no less difficult than in social networks.
Gates also commented on people’s concerns about AI-generated content interfering with the 2024 US election campaign. According to him, this is possible, but most likely this impact of artificial intelligence on the process will be insignificant.
